Peterson Air Force Base Relocation
Peterson Air Force Base is adjacent to and east of Colorado Springs off U.S. Highway 24. Colorado Springs is the second largest city in the state and has a population of approximately 500,000 people. Colorado Springs also hosts the U.S. Air Force Academy to the north and Fort Carson to the south. The Colorado Springs Airport, which shares runways with Peterson, services the area with direct connections to a wide variety of major cities. City buses make stops at the Peterson gate.
Due to the shortage of on-post housing, most military personnel choose to live off-base. There is only 490 family housing units available on-post. Schriever Air Force Base Relocation
Schriever Air Force Base is one of the newest bases in the Air Force. Schriever AFB is the home of the 50th Space Wing, the Space Innovation and Development Center, the Missile Defense Agency's Joint National Integration Center, 310th Space Group and numerous tenant organizations. The 50th Space Wing's mission provide combat effects to the warfighter, to include precision navigation and timing and secure satellite communication, through command and control of DOD satellite systems. The other units at Schriever also perform space missions. Schriever AFB is unique in that it has no flightline and no aircraft mission. Some of the services normally provided at most Air Force bases are not available on Schriever.
Schriever Air Force Base has no on-base housing as housing is provided by Peterson Air Force Base. Military personnel relocating to Schriever AFB usually live in Falcon, Powers, Central Colorado Springs, Security/Widefield and Briargate areas. Commute times to base range from 15-35 minutes.
